    2. Japan's drunk driving system penalties.

    In Japan, drunkenness is punishable by imprisonment of up to 10 years, plus a fine of up to 1 million yen, and the license cannot be obtained for more than 3 years but not more than 10 years. In particular, if you are advised to drink alcohol in Japan and the driver is drunk driving, the person who advised you to drink alcohol is also jointly and severally liable.

    According to Japan's "Law on the Prevention of Drunkenness and Disrupting Public Order", compulsory persuasion of alcohol will be punished by imprisonment of up to 48 hours and a fine of up to 10,000 yuan; If the person being advised to drink is involved in a traffic accident or accident, the person who advised the person to drink shall be jointly and severally guilty. And if the driver is drunk and the other passengers in the car do not stop and dissuade them, they will also be subject to fines and criminal penalties. Japan, as a major automobile country comparable to Europe and the United States, has very strict penalties for drunk driving, and under this strict law, Japan's drunk driving behavior has also been greatly reduced.

    1. What is drunk driving? What is Drunk Driving?

    Drunk driving is the driver's 100 ml blood alcohol content reaches 20-80 mg, drunk driving is the driver's 100 ml blood alcohol content of more than 80 mg, in layman's terms, the amount of a small glass of beer, a small cup of liquor, to determine the drunk driving is undoubted.

    Alcohol testing. 2. Penalties for drunk driving and penalties for drunk driving.

    1. Drinking and driving a motor vehicle, a fine of 1,000 yuan to 2,000 yuan, 12 points and a temporary suspension of the driver's license for 6 months; Those who are punished for driving a motor vehicle after drinking alcohol and drive a motor vehicle after drinking alcohol again are to be detained for up to 10 days, fined between 1,000 and 2,000 RMB, and have their motor vehicle driver's license revoked. Driving a motor vehicle under the influence of alcohol shall be fined 5,000 yuan, 12 demerit points, detained for up to 15 days, and shall not be allowed to re-obtain a driver's license for 5 years.

    2. Driving a motor vehicle while intoxicated shall have the driver's license directly revoked, and the driver's license shall not be re-obtained within 5 years, and shall be sentenced to criminal detention and punishment after the judgment. Driving a commercial motor vehicle while intoxicated shall have his driver's license revoked, and he shall not be allowed to re-obtain a driver's license for 10 years, and shall not be allowed to drive a commercial vehicle for life, and shall be sentenced to criminal detention and a fine after a judgment.

    3. If a major traffic accident occurs after drinking alcohol or driving a motor vehicle while drunk, and a crime is constituted, criminal responsibility shall be investigated in accordance with the law, and the motor vehicle driver's license shall be revoked by the traffic management department of the public security organ, and the motor vehicle driver's license shall not be re-obtained for life.

    Article 133 of the Criminal Law [Traffic Accident Crime; Dangerous driving] Whoever violates traffic and transportation management regulations, thereby causing a major accident, causing serious injury or death, or causing major losses to public or private property, shall be sentenced to fixed-term imprisonment of not more than three years or short-term detention; Where a person escapes after causing a traffic accident or has other especially heinous circumstances, a sentence of between three and seven years imprisonment is to be given; Whoever causes death as a result of escape shall be sentenced to fixed-term imprisonment of not less than seven years.

    Article 133-1 Anyone who drives a motor vehicle on a road in any of the following circumstances is to be sentenced to short-term detention and a concurrent fine:

    1) Chasing and racing, where the circumstances are heinous;

    2) Driving a motor vehicle while intoxicated;

    C) engaged in school bus business or passenger transport, seriously exceeding the rated occupant capacity, or seriously exceeding the speed limit;

    4) Transporting hazardous chemicals in violation of the regulations on the safety management of hazardous chemicals, endangering public safety.

    Where the owner or manager of a motor vehicle bears direct responsibility for the conduct in items (3) or (4) of the preceding paragraph, punishment is to be given in accordance with the provisions of the preceding paragraph.

    Where conduct in the preceding two paragraphs simultaneously constitutes other crimes, follow the provisions for the heavier punishment at trial and sentencing.

    According to this law, anyone who drives a motor vehicle while intoxicated shall be sentenced to criminal detention and a fine.
